+From 600a8cded447cd7118ed50142c576567c0cf5158 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Daniel Stenberg <daniel@haxx.se>
+Date: Thu, 14 May 2020 14:37:12 +0200
+Subject: [PATCH] url: make the updated credentials URL-encoded in the URL
+
+Found-by: Gregory Jefferis
+Reported-by: Jeroen Ooms
+Added test 1168 to verify. Bug spotted when doing a redirect.
+Bug: https://github.com/jeroen/curl/issues/224
+Closes #5400
+---
+ lib/url.c | 6 ++--
+ tests/data/Makefile.inc | 1 +
+ tests/data/test1168 | 78 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
+ 3 files changed, 83 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
+ create mode 100644 tests/data/test1168
+
+diff --git a/lib/url.c b/lib/url.c
+index f250f2ff20a..9b8b2bdde64 100644
+--- a/lib/url.c
++++ b/lib/url.c
+@@ -2788,12 +2788,14 @@ static CURLcode override_login(struct Curl_easy *data,
+
+ /* for updated strings, we update them in the URL */
+ if(user_changed) {
+- uc = curl_url_set(data->state.uh, CURLUPART_USER, *userp, 0);
++ uc = curl_url_set(data->state.uh, CURLUPART_USER, *userp,
++ CURLU_URLENCODE);
+ if(uc)
+ return Curl_uc_to_curlcode(uc);
+ }
+ if(passwd_changed) {
+- uc = curl_url_set(data->state.uh, CURLUPART_PASSWORD, *passwdp, 0);
++ uc = curl_url_set(data->state.uh, CURLUPART_PASSWORD, *passwdp,
++ CURLU_URLENCODE);
+ if(uc)
+ return Curl_uc_to_curlcode(uc);
+ }

+From 8236aba58542c5f89f1d41ca09d84579efb05e22 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Daniel Stenberg <daniel@haxx.se>
+Date: Sun, 31 May 2020 23:09:59 +0200
+Subject: [PATCH] tool_getparam: -i is not OK if -J is used
+
+Reported-by: sn on hackerone
+Bug: https://curl.haxx.se/docs/CVE-2020-8177.html
+---
+ src/tool_cb_hdr.c | 22 ++++------------------
+ src/tool_getparam.c | 5 +++++
+ 2 files changed, 9 insertions(+), 18 deletions(-)
+
+diff --git a/src/tool_cb_hdr.c b/src/tool_cb_hdr.c
+index 3b102388866..b80707fde57 100644
+--- a/src/tool_cb_hdr.c
++++ b/src/tool_cb_hdr.c
+@@ -186,25 +186,11 @@ size_t tool_header_cb(char *ptr, size_t size, size_t nmemb, void *userdata)
+ filename = parse_filename(p, len);
+ if(filename) {
+ if(outs->stream) {
+- int rc;
+- /* already opened and possibly written to */
+- if(outs->fopened)
+- fclose(outs->stream);
+- outs->stream = NULL;
+-
+- /* rename the initial file name to the new file name */
+- rc = rename(outs->filename, filename);
+- if(rc != 0) {
+- warnf(per->config->global, "Failed to rename %s -> %s: %s\n",
+- outs->filename, filename, strerror(errno));
+- }
+- if(outs->alloc_filename)
+- Curl_safefree(outs->filename);
+- if(rc != 0) {
+- free(filename);
+- return failure;
+- }
++ /* indication of problem, get out! */
++ free(filename);
++ return failure;
+ }
++
+ outs->is_cd_filename = TRUE;
+ outs->s_isreg = TRUE;
+ outs->fopened = FALSE;
+diff --git a/src/tool_getparam.c b/src/tool_getparam.c
+index 0cd11c47986..1ab3983f4ac 100644
+--- a/src/tool_getparam.c
++++ b/src/tool_getparam.c
+@@ -1817,6 +1817,11 @@ ParameterError getparameter(const char *flag, /* f or -long-flag */
+ }
+ break;
+ case 'i':
++ if(config->content_disposition) {
++ warnf(global,
++ "--include and --remote-header-name cannot be combined.\n");
++ return PARAM_BAD_USE;
++ }
+ config->show_headers = toggle; /* show the headers as well in the
+ general output stream */
+ break;
